1. Preparing Ingredients: An Essential Step
Before you start cooking, it is crucial to ensure that all ingredients are prepared in advance. This step, although often overlooked, saves valuable time during cooking. To do this, it is advisable to adopt a mise en place method. Gather all the necessary ingredients and prepare them by cutting, measuring, and cleaning before you begin. This not only increases your efficiency but also enhances your cooking experience.
Use quality stainless steel kitchen utensils to ensure clean and precise cuts. A good knife, such as those from the Victorinox brand, greatly facilitates the task. For vegetables, uniform cuts will allow for even cooking, preventing some pieces from being undercooked or burned. Remember to use different cutting boards to avoid cross-contamination.
2. Effective Cutting Techniques
Cutting techniques vary, and each method has its importance depending on the ingredient to be prepared. For example, the brunoise technique involves cutting vegetables into perfect small cubes, while julienne is ideal for strips. For herbs, finely chopping enhances dishes with their concentrated aroma.
The precision of these cuts directly affects the presentation and flavor balance of a dish. A well-cut dish is not only visually appealing but also contributes to an even distribution of flavors. 1. Roasting: A Timeless Classic
Roasting is a classic cooking method that can be used for various types of meat. This essential cooking method requires properly searing the meat in a hot pan before transferring it to the oven. This technique helps retain juices and develop rich flavors through caramelization.
Choose a quality Tefal casserole that allows for even heat distribution. This prevents food from sticking and facilitates handling. For a tasty pork roast, season it with herbs, garlic, and olive oil before placing it in the oven. The results are often incredible and will impress your guests.
2. Steaming: Health First
Steaming is a light cooking method that preserves the nutrients and colors of vegetables. By using a steamer or placing a colander over a pot, you can achieve crispy vegetables that retain their benefits.
This technique offers you the opportunity to discover the power of seasoning. Feel free to flavor the water with herbs, lemon, or even broth to enhance the taste. Steamed vegetables pair perfectly with light sauces or even dressings for a delicious and nutritious dish.

1. Basic Sauces
There are a few basic sauces like béchamel, tomato sauce, or hollandaise that are indispensable for any cook. Béchamel, for example, is perfect for gratins and lasagna. To prepare it, melt butter, incorporate flour, then gradually add milk while whisking. This achieves a smooth consistency ideal for your dishes.
As for tomato sauce, it is a classic of Italian cuisine. Sauté garlic and onions in olive oil before adding crushed tomatoes, salt, and herbs. Let it simmer until the flavors meld together. This will yield a rich and savory sauce perfect for pasta.
